Originally posted by Midlands Eagle

It's fairly obvious that we have financial issues but I doubt whether they are anywhere near the scale that the OP mentioned.

If as he says we are losing £30 pa and are £180m in debt then that means that in the year ended 30th June 2018 we would have been £150m in debt and we were not

I've just looked up the accounts for the year ended 30th June 2018 and according to the consolidated accounts we made an operating profit of £9m but a net loss of £35m after player trading and we had net assets of £3.4m

To turn the net assets position of £3.4m into a deficit of £180m would not only imply massive losses for the year but also fraudulent activity by the directors and that just isn't the case
